How do I do a rent to own agreement?
In a rent-to-own agreement, you (as the buyer) pay the seller a one-time, usually nonrefundable, upfront fee called the option fee, option money, or option consideration. This fee is what gives you the option to buy the house by some date in the future. The option fee is often negotiable, as there's no standard rate. -

How do you set up a rent to own?
You sign one of two types of agreements. ... You and the landlord set a purchase price. ... You pay an option fee. ... You decide how long the rental term will be. ... Maintenance roles will be defined. ... Your monthly payment covers rent and down payment savings. ... When the rental term nears its end, you apply for a mortgage. -

Can you get out of a rent to own contract?
When you sign a rent-to-own contract, you agree to purchase the home at the end of the lease. ... If you decide you no longer want the home, you'll likely lose the money you paid to enter into the agreement. However, under certain circumstances, it's possible to get out of the contract. -

Do you sign a lease the day you move in?
Typically, you end up signing the lease agreement between 30 and 60 days before moving into the unit if you have a previous lease agreement. Tenants without prior commitments could sign the lease and receive the keys on the same day. -
What if I lost my tenancy agreement?
If you cannot locate your original tenancy lease, simply ask your landlord or rental management agency to send you a copy for your records. ... Keep a copy of your request on file in case you do not hear back from your landlord or property manager. -
Can you move in before your move in date?
That depends on the landlord and what your lease says. Once you pay the deposits and any pro-rated rent, and done the pre-move in walk-through, you should get the keys. But you should NOT be allowed to move anything into the property until the move-in date, which is the first date for which you've paid rent. -

[Music] hello again everyone I'm attorney Robert fleshes before you enter into a residential lease agreement as a tenant or if you're a landlord drafting a rental agreement to give to a tenant you really need to watch this video I'm going to tell you about seven possible provisions that could be included in the lease that could be illegal rendering the entire lease void which means the lease isn't enforceable and if you find this video helpful please consider subscribing to my channel remember that every state has different landlord tenant laws but the seven contract terms that I'm going to discuss in this video are probably illegal in most states the illegal terms that I'm discussing do not impose criminal liability on the landlord first let's talk about the form of the lease many landlords download boilerplate leases from the internet in order to avoid paying attorney to prepare a valid and effective residential lease or to pay for a state-approved lease containing enforceable terms in many states there are vendors that will produce valid leases with all of the terms that are allowable in a particular state some boilerplate leases that a landlord can download for free on the internet contain illegal terms or terms that your particular state doesn't allow many times landlords actually add terms into the lease that they dream up on their own that are illegal or unenforceable for tenants instead of just signing a lease tenants need to read the entire lease not only to know what you're getting into but to see if there are any illegal terms the lease before signing it for landlords you need to review your state laws regarding tenant agreements so that a court won't void your lease if there's ever a dispute and you're relying on the terms of the lease to evict a tenant here are the seven lease provisions that are probably unenforceable in most states in most leases a landlord has a provision that any damage caused directly by the tenant or their guests or invitees imposes liability on the tenant well that provision is okay but a provision that makes the tenant liable for damage that arises clearly out of the tenants control is usually illegal for example let's see some kids are playing baseball outside your building one of the kids and not yours smacks the ball and it smashes your window kids playing baseball the premise this is something that you can't control and the resulting damage to your rental you and it was damage that you couldn't control either another lease provision that's usually illegal is when a landlord makes a tenant waive the landlord's statutory or legal obligation to deliver the rental unit in a fit and habitable condition or even maintain the premises for you so that landlords provision is attempting you to accept a beat-up uninhabitable unit or without the landlord having any liability for such a condition or a unit where the toilet doesn't...
